      Subpart B_Certification of Substantially Equivalent Agencies

 

Sec.  115.201  Basis of determination.



    A determination to certify an agency as substantially equivalent 

involves a two-phase procedure. The determination requires examination 

and an affirmative conclusion by the Assistant Secretary on two separate 

inquiries:

    (a) Whether the law, administered by the agency, on its face, 

satisfies the criteria set forth in section 810(f)(3)(A) of the Act; and

    (b) Whether the current practices and past performance of the agency 

demonstrate that, in operation, the law in fact provides rights and 

remedies which are substantially equivalent to those provided in the 

Act.
